MIL-V-81995(AS)
4.5.20
Individual inspection tests.
4.5.20.1
Examination.  Each valve shall be subjected to a
careful inspection to insure all external dimensional tolerances are
within specification and drawing limits and that all parts are correctly
assembled.
4.5.20.2
Dielectric strength.  The valve's electrical circuit
shall be subjected to a dielectric strength test which meets the requirements
of MIL-G21480.
4.5.20.3
Proof pressure for quality conformance. With the
valve in the closed position and the outlet port open to atmospheric
pressure, apply an air pressure equal to two times the maximum inlet air
pressure, as specified in the specification sheet, to the inlet port of
the valve for a period of 1 minute  Repeat this test except that the
valve shall be in the open position and the outlet port shall be capped.
4.5.20.4
cycling.  The valve shall be operated for 5 cycles
at ambient temperature using air at rated inlet pressure and temperature
and 14-volt do electrical power applied to the receptacle terminal.
4.5.20.5
Actuation. The valve shall be connected to a 28-
volt do electrical power source and actuated twice at each of the inlet
conditions specified in the specification sheet,  Valve operation shall
be smooth and the opening and closing rates shall be within the limits
specified herein and in the specification sheet.  Current draw shall not
exceed that specified in 3.6.10.
4.5.20.6
Leakage for quality conformance. Internal and total
leakage shall be measured with the valve in the closed position and with
the valve inlet air at ambient temperature and minimum pressure and then
at maximum temperature and maximum pressure specified in the specification
sheet and shall not exceed the limits specified in the specification
sheet.
5.
PACKAGING
5.1
Application.  The requirements specified herein
apply only to direct purchases by or direct shipments to the Government.
5.2
Presentation.  All ports shall be sealed by closures
conforming to MIL-C-5501.  All exterior surfaces of the component shall
be protected by corrosion-preventative compounds conforming to MIL-C-
11796 or MIL-C-16173.  The component shall then be wrapped or bagged in
Grade A greaseproof paper conforming to MIL-B-l2l and sealed with tape
conforming to PPP-T-600
